Using Multipathing with Path Provisioning
You can use provisioning with multipathing. Set the Host Customize Dialog to the multipathing
option. Then, repeat the provisioning steps for each path, as described in the following steps:
1. Select one of the following system actions:
Volume Creation + LUN Security + Zoning - First you create a meta volume. Second, you
map a meta volume to a Fibre Channel port and host HBAs (HSG). Third, you create a zone.
See ”Volume Creation, LUN Security, and Zone Operation” on page 426 for more
information.
LUN Security - Map meta volume to Fibre Channel port and host HBAs (HSG). See the
topic ”LUN Security” on page 432for more information.
Zone Operation - Create a new zone. See ”Zone Operation” on page 437 for more
information.
2. Select a storage system, and then click the Step 1 button.
3. Click the button above the Host pane.
4. Select the following option:
Multipath: Select more than one port within a single server.
5. Select a port on a host. Then, click the Step 2 button.
6. Select a volume, host security group and/or zone, as described in the following topics:
•”LUN Security” on page 432
•”Zone Operation” on page 437
7. Select the second path from the Path combo box
8. Repeat Step 6.
You do not need to select a system action, storage system, and host. Furthermore, you must select
the same host used for the first path.
9. Set the schedule for the job as described in the topic, ”Scheduling Provisioning Jobs” on
page 455.
You can narrow the types of volumes displayed in the Volume pane by setting the Volume Customize
Dialog.
